Crank but no start
I just finished swapping in a 5spd into my 95 s14 that was an automatic. While doing the swap I pulled my motor to put a new one in that i got from a friend that had an s13. I have already done the over ride to make the car start without the clutch pressed in. When I put the s13 ka24de in I swapped the distributors since the plugs were different and used my s14 maf. The car will crank but it will not start or even act like it wants to start. What could I have missed?

I tried that and there was no difference. I just installed a new walbro 255 and 300zx fuel filter. I can hear the pump turning on and have pulled an injector to verify that they are spraying. I have tripple checked my timing and it is dead on. I also did a compression test and it was near perfect across all cylinders. The only thing I can think of is it has to be something with the ECU or a connector somewhere. I have read every auto to manual swap thread and I followed every step with the exception that instead of just swapping trannys I swapped motors and trannys.
